A Handy Checklist
Planning a vacation road trip can be exciting. Still, ensuring your car is in top shape before hitting the open road is essential. By following a simple checklist, you can ensure your vehicle is ready for the trip. From checking the fluids to inspecting the tires, this guide will help you prepare your car for a safe and enjoyable vacation travel experience.
- Check Fluid Levels—Checking your car's oil, coolant, brake fluid, and windshield washer fluid levels will ensure they are all at the appropriate levels and filled if needed. Inspecting for any leaks that may need attention before setting off on your trip is also a good idea.
- Inspect Tires—Check the tire pressure and tread depth on all four tires, including the spare. Underinflated tires may affect fuel efficiency and handling, while worn-out treads can increase the risk of blowouts. We can rotate or replace tires if necessary to ensure optimal performance during your travels.
- Test Lights and Signals—Walk around your car and check that all lights are functioning properly—headlights, taillights, turn signals, and brake lights. We can replace any burnt-out bulbs before heading out on your journey to ensure maximum visibility and safety on the road.
- Check Brakes—Our certified technicians can check your braking system, including pads and rotors, to ensure they are in good shape. Squeaking or grinding noises when braking could indicate worn-out brakes that need immediate attention before embarking on a long drive.
- Pack Emergency Supplies—Assemble an emergency kit for your car that includes items such as jumper cables, a flashlight, batteries, a first aid kit, water bottles, non-perishable snacks, blankets, a phone charger, and tools like a jack and lug wrench. Be prepared for unexpected roadside emergencies during your vacation travels.
